Could someone point me out to some documentation or explain to me what exactly is regarded as a "link-flap" for error-disable detection ?
Is this one up/down in one second ? three up/downs in 2 seconds ? four consequetive up/down ?

Hey Geert,
The interface is put into the errdisabled state if it flaps more than five times in 10 seconds.
